Poor self-esteem

The connection between ADHD and low self-esteem was investigated in greater detail in recent years. It's clear that both genders are susceptible to this condition and that early treatment may prevent it from becoming a more serious personality disorder.

Research has shown that the risk of developing substance use disorders is much higher in young people who suffer from ADHD. They are more likely to smoke, drink and use other substances during their adolescent or adult years. These symptoms may be associated with inattention or impulsivity. These symptoms can be reduced through effective interventions and an improved quality of life.

ADHD females may have difficulty maintaining their social skills and interpersonal relationships or sexual performance. This makes it difficult for them access support from peers and increase their chances of being sexually victimized.

Females suffering from ADHD are at greater risk than adolescents for developing an addiction disorder. Substance abuse is often used to deal with feelings of being inadequate. This comorbidity may manifest as moodiness, irritability and anxiety.

Some studies have proven that the relationship between ADHD and low self-esteem may be addressed through psychoeducation, CBT, and medication. These interventions can boost executive function, planning and time management skills. Behavioral strategies to reduce impulsivity and anxiety can help reduce the risk of developing substance abuse disorders.

A thorough evaluation of ADHD will be able to identify both functional and symptom-like symptoms across various settings, including social, occupational, and educational environments. Neuropsychological tests can also be helpful in the process of completing the assessment.

Undiagnosed, or not properly diagnosed

For many people being diagnosed with ADHD is a frightening experience. The disorder can cause many unintended consequences in the life of the patient. Getting a proper diagnosis can help alleviate some of the pain and suffering that comes with the disorder.

Many ADHD sufferers aren't aware their condition exists. It can also make it difficult to pinpoint the exact cause of their symptoms. This can result in delayed diagnoses, and sometimes even delayed treatment.

coe-2022.pngADHD prevalence is significantly lower for females than for males. Gender stereotypes are one reason. The majority of society expects women to assume the role of primary caretaker, and if a woman is too disorganized her parents aren't likely to worry.

The medical community continues to find out more about ADHD symptoms in girls and women. Women with ADHD face difficulties in focusing, difficulty finding and arranging things, as well as difficulty in focusing.

In addition women who suffer from the disorder are more likely to be suffering from anxiety, depression and other mood disorders. These disorders can result in women who are stressed and underachieving.

Women who suffer from the disorder also experience an increase in self-esteem problems. The condition can make relationships with loved ones more difficult. Girls with the condition are more likely to engage in unwanted sexual activity and are at risk for teen pregnancy.

ADHD treatment can help sufferers manage their condition and improve their everyday functioning. Cognitive behavioral therapy, medication and other treatments are a few of the options.
